Output 6cc4fe58654d00f4a2a653bff9ece9ee34fe7b5d0934941fb6a2a20c513170a9:47

value
1052972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c368acba770d3f746f1b5b8e82021c28380f838 OP_EQUAL
address
3D1o3zCyf1KgDG1u83H5aq5ehDwLZo4Zae
transaction
6cc4fe58654d00f4a2a653bff9ece9ee34fe7b5d0934941fb6a2a20c513170a9
confirmations
273416
spent
true